Chicken Piccata is a bright and tangy dish that brings a burst of flavor with every bite! Tender chicken breasts are sautéed to perfection and smothered in a lemony butter sauce with capers. It’s a light and refreshing dish that’s as easy to make as it is delicious!
Ingredients
Directions
- Place 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ts between two sheets of plastic wrap and pound them to about 1/2-inch thickness. Season both sides with salt and pepper. Dredge the chicken lightly in 1/2 cup of all-purpose flour, shaking off any excess.
- He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the chicken breasts and cook for 3-4 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and cooked through.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side.
- In the same skillet,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at. Add 2 minced garlic cloves and sauté for about 30 seconds, until fragrant. Pour in 1/2 cup of chicken broth and 1/4 cup of fresh lemon juice,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pan. Bring to a simmer and cook for 3 minutes, or until the sauce is slightly reduced.
- Stir in 2 tablespoons of capers and 1/4 cup of chopped fresh parsley. Return the chicken breasts to the skillet and spoon the sauce over them. Let the chicken simmer in the sauce for an additional 2 minutes to absorb the flavors.
- Plate the chicken breasts and pour the remaining sauce over the top. Garnish with extra fresh parsley and lemon slices if desired. Serve hot with a side of pasta, rice, or steamed vegetables for a complete meal.
